General applications in garment cutting fields:
Bulk Garment Production Cutting: Integrated into fully automated cutting machine systems, the red cross lines serve as the positioning reference for cut pieces, marking the fabric layout origin and direction reference. This ensures complete overlap of cutting positions for multiple layers of fabric (typically 50-100 layers), improving the dimensional consistency of batch cut pieces and reducing waste rates.
Precision Cutting for Custom-Made Garments: 650nm red cross line laser module is used for single-piece cutting of high-end custom-made suits, evening gowns and other garments. Red crosshairs mark key positions such as the axis of symmetry, neckline reference point, and armhole alignment line, assisting tailors in accurately grasping the pattern proportions and solving the problems of asymmetry and large errors associated with manual marking.
Cutting of Irregularly Shaped Pieces and Joinery: For special components such as lace, embroidered patches, and irregular decorative pieces, red cross laser alignment can mark their installation alignment references, facilitating subsequent sewing and joining. They can also be used for bias cutting of fabrics, ensuring that the grain of the bias-cut fabric conforms to design requirements.
Cutting of Home Textiles: Extended applications include cutting curtains, bed sheets, sofa covers, and other home textile products. Red alignment laser mark the cutting boundaries and center of symmetry of large-sized fabrics, especially suitable for batch cutting of wide fabrics, improving cutting efficiency and the uniformity of finished products.

Applications in the machining industry:
Machine tool setting assistance: This 635nm red cross line laser module can be installed on lathes, milling machines, and other machine tools to project cross lines onto the workpiece, helping operators quickly and accurately determine the relative position of the tool and workpiece, reducing tool setting time and improving machining accuracy.
Part assembly positioning: In scenarios such as automotive production lines, red alignment laser acts as the “eyes” of the robotic arm, projecting red cross lines to enable robots to precisely install parts like car doors, with an error controllable within 0.5mm.
Equipment calibration: Crosshairs projected on CNC machine tools can be used to calibrate the X/Y axes for absolute parallelism. On conveyor belts, crosshairs can be used to indicate belt deviation, facilitating quick adjustments.
Quality Inspection Marking: After cutting steel plates, a crosshair projection can be used to quickly verify the verticality of the cut edges. For plastic parts, a red line can be used to mark the product edge, making it easier to detect defects such as burrs through a magnifying glass.

Applications in scientific research and experiment:

In optical experiments, 650nm red cross line laser module can be used as a light path indicator to help build and adjust complex optical systems so as to ensure that light propagates along the predetermined path. In materials science research, it is used to mark sample positions or specific areas for easy observation and analysis.

In biological experiments, this accessory part of red cross laser alignment tool can assist in locating cells or tissues, such as providing a reference red cross line source for accurately finding the target area when observing under a microscope. In some physical experiments, it can also be used to measure small displacements or angle changes, and accurately determine the amount of change by moving the red cross line laser source.
